在前端开发中,字体选择是构建美观、易读且具有良好用户体验的网页的关键因素之一。正确的字体选择不仅能够提升视觉效果,还能增强用户阅读体验和品牌识别度。本文将深入探讨前端框架中字体选择的策略,以及如何通过字体设计提升用户体验与视觉冲击。
字体选择的重要性
1. 品牌识别
字体是品牌形象的重要组成部分。通过选择与品牌定位相匹配的字体,可以强化品牌识别度,让用户在第一时间内对品牌产生印象。
2. 阅读体验
易读性是字体选择的首要考虑因素。合适的字体可以提高内容的可读性,减少用户阅读时的疲劳感。
3. 视觉冲击
独特的字体设计可以为网页带来视觉上的冲击力,提升整体的美观度。
字体选择策略
1. 字体家族的选择
选择合适的字体家族是基础。常见的字体家族包括:
- Serif:衬线字体,如Times New Roman、Georgia,适合正式文档。
- Sans-serif:无衬线字体,如Arial、Helvetica,适合现代设计。
- Monospace:等宽字体,如Courier New、Lucida Console,适合代码显示。
2. 字体格式的选择
考虑字体格式对兼容性和性能的影响。常见的字体格式包括:
- TrueType (.ttf)
- OpenType (.otf)
- Web Open Font Format (WOFF, WOFF2)
3. 字体样式的选择
根据需求选择字体样式,如粗体、斜体、下划线等,以增强文本的视觉效果。
实践案例
以下是一个使用CSS @font-face导入外部字体的示例代码:
@font-face {
font-family: 'MyCustomFont';
src: url('fonts/MyCustomFont.woff2') format('woff2'),
url('fonts/MyCustomFont.woff') format('woff');
font-weight: normal;
font-style: normal;
}
body {
font-family: 'MyCustomFont', sans-serif;
}
提升用户体验与视觉冲击
1. 设计一致性
保持网页中字体风格的一致性,包括字体大小、颜色和样式,以提供统一的视觉体验。
2. 响应式设计
确保字体在不同设备上的显示效果,通过媒体查询调整字体大小和行高,以适应不同屏幕尺寸。
3. 字体性能优化
优化字体文件大小,使用字体子集技术,以减少加载时间,提升页面性能。
4. 无障碍设计
遵循WCAG 2.0标准,确保字体颜色与背景的对比度,满足无障碍阅读的需求。
通过以上的字体选择策略和实践案例,前端开发者可以更好地提升用户体验与视觉冲击,打造出既美观又实用的网页设计。
